Session Summary

Session 28 · February 12, 2026

20 Harpa (Women's Month / Spring)

Mech Factory

  • Virfir introduced you to Hefti, who runs the mech factory.

  • Hefti showed you around the inactive workshop - they've stopped building mechs because of the challenges.

    • She demonstrated a mech, then some of its misbehavior.

    • She told you that she's checked everything mechanical and couldn't find any problems.

    • She told you that there are runes that control behavior. She knows how to carve them but she doesn't completely understand them. She asked you to take a look.

  • Upon examination of the runes, you discovered that a rune on a misbehaving mech had changed.

  • You asked about references and she gave you a few - she can draw them from memory, she has a "book" that shows them, or you can look at a mech that she knows works correctly.

  • You chose to start with the book and discovered that, yes, the rune you identified as changed is, indeed, very subtly different. It's subtle - less like changing an F to a P and more like slightly changing a single angle or line.

  • You asked Hefti draw a rune and she did that on a piece of scrap - she drew it to match the book.

  • You learned that there's a maintenance bay where mechs returning from the field are repaired and Hefti took you there.

Mech Maintenance

  • Hefty introduced you to Thrain who runs the repair bay.

  • Thrain shared some info:

    • He confirmed that Hefti's runes are always right.

    • He said his engineers don't change runes; they do mechanical repairs.

  • You inspected mechs in the bay and found some that had altered runes and some that didn't.

  • There was no pattern evident initially - age, number of times in the bay - nothing.

  • You asked about who worked on what and Thrain produced a log.

  • After examining the log, you focused on 2 dwarves who worked on the mechs with altered runes and had notes that they transferred in to the maintenance area.

  • You went back to Hefti to ask about them, then back to Thrain to ask about where to find them.

Ledge Overlooking Magma River

  • You found Skirfnir where Thrain suggested he would be and started a conversation with him.

  • He started out giving the typical dwarf answers but you eventually figured out he wasn't telling the whole truth.

  • Pushing him, you discovered more info:

    • Skirfnir and some others had been modifying the runes because a contingent of dwarves wants to invade the fire giant stronghold to free Sif.

    • Lots of dwarves will die when that happens. He and his allies would prefer that lots of dwarves don't die to maybe free Sif.

    • There is a prophecy that heroes would arrive and that would be the tipping point that ensures that Sif gets freed.

    • This prophetic voice speaks to some dwarves and not to others, and some believe and some do not.

Return to Virfir

  • You told Virfir that you have some information about the mechs but you need to go investigate this voice or echo or whatever it is before you can be sure what's happening.

  • That's something he wanted you to do anyway.

21 Harpa

Tunnels Beneath Dwarf Stronghold

  • After a respite (congrats on Gold Rank), you set out for the caverns where Virfir told you that you might find the voice.

  • It isn't in a specific place; it's more of a pilgrimage or "walkabout" and the voice will come or it won't.

  • On your path, some gold rank monsters - cloakers - attacked. They had their auras hidden so you didn't realize they were there until they descended from the ceiling.
